CERN Junior Fellowship Program is the highest-paying Fellowship Program in Switzerland for Undergraduate and Master’s programs, this Fellowship Program is the highest-paying Fellowship Program in Europe. This is a great opportunity for talented youth from all over the world to apply, there is no application fee, also, you can apply without IELTS / TOEFL, the CERN Junior Program is open to undergraduate and postgraduate students.
No work experience is required to apply for a CERN Fellowship.
These international fellowships are fully funded for both local and international students.
In addition, a wide range of applied sciences, engineering, computing, and other application research programs are available
This program will cover all types of expenses.
Hundreds of scholarships are available to apply and the duration of the fellowships is 6 months minimum and 36 months maximum. You can also visit to apply for free British Council online courses for the summer semester.

1- Selected applicants receive a salary between 5300 and 6600 Swiss francs per month 2. A complete medical / health plan for the participants and their families. (For yourself. Your husband. Children)
3- CERN Pension Membership Funds
4- Return flight tickets
5- Paid leave
6- Family grants
The CERN Junior Fellowship application is completely online.
